Descrição
Delving into the unsettling and mysterious, this latest issue of Weird Horror serves up a captivating collection of stories that dance on the edge of dread and wonder. With contributions from a diverse array of authors, readers are transported through dark woods, serpentine nightmares, and the haunting echoes of the unexplained. Each tale brims with unique voices and chilling plots that linger long after the last page is turned.
As one descends into this thrilling anthology, they will find themselves entwined in the intricate web of human fears, strange encounters, and the eerie beauty of the unknown. From William Curnow's exploration of the eerie woods to Oluwatomiwa Ajeigbe's enigmatic "Deathflower," the imaginative richness of each piece invites readers to unravel complex narratives that challenge perceptions of reality.
The collection embodies the essence of weird horror, filled with heart-pounding moments and unexpected twists. Each author brings their own flair, ensuring that the journey through these haunted pages is nothing short of unforgettable, making it a must-read for anyone craving a taste of the bizarre and the astonishing.
